There are a few interesting parallels between Jeff Traylor and Art Briles.

Both were very successful HS HC with state championships to their record.

Traylor had three stints as an assistant college coach. Briles had one.

Both started their collegiate career at 52/53 years of age.

UH was Art’s first college gig, UTSA is Jeff’s first gig.

Both finished 7-5 in their first year and lost their first bowl game.

Both were good recruiters. Art recruited west Texas effectively. Traylor recruits east Texas effectively and was Big 12 Recruiter of the Year in .2016.

Art’s second hire was Baylor. He transformed Baylor into a national power. UH is in a better place today than when Art took over the program in 2002. Maybe Traylor can make UH into a national power.

If I thought that Traylor could become another Art Briles (without the baggage), then I would be onboard to the hire.

I’ve watched highlights, but not full games. From what I can tell, he’s more of a Multiple Offense guy than UH is used to – lots of TEs and Power runs and even some under center play. Still usually One Back and from the Shotgun, but pretty run-heavy. That said, the Runners are leading the nation in Offensive Plays/Game, so they sort of have to be up-tempo by definition.
